This set of five Japanese lacquerware bowls with matching lids exemplifies the refined beauty of traditional Aizu-nuri 会津塗craftsmanship. Each bowl is finished in a deep, lustrous burgundy-red lacquer and delicately decorated with hand-painted gold motifs of bamboo and rice plants—symbols of prosperity, resilience, and good fortune in Japanese culture. The harmonious blend of color and design captures the timeless elegance of Japanese aesthetics, making these bowls perfect for serving soup, rice, or special dishes.

Aizu-nuri lacquerware, originating from the Aizu region of Fukushima Prefecture, has a history spanning over 500 years. It is known for its meticulous multi-layered lacquering process, which gives each piece a rich sheen and exceptional durability. These bowls were produced by Ichihashi Shikki Seisakusho, a respected maker of traditional lacquerware that continues to preserve and share this cultural art form.
